About

The Cell Engineering MSc by Research at the University of Glasgow focuses on the application of engineering principles to cell biology. This one-year program explores topics such as stem cell biology, tissue engineering, and regenerative medicine. Students will conduct research to understand how cells can be manipulated for therapeutic purposes, including the development of new treatments for diseases.

Graduates will be prepared for careers in biomedical research, biotechnology, and the pharmaceutical industry, where they can contribute to the development of advanced medical technologies and therapies that harness the power of cell engineering.

Program Structure

Semester 1 – Foundations of Cell Engineering

  • Introduction to Cell Biology and Engineering Principles
  • Stem Cells and Tissue Engineering
  • Molecular Biology Techniques in Cell Engineering
  • Cell Culture and Biomaterials
  • Research Methods in Bioengineering

Semester 2 – Advanced Cell Engineering Techniques and Applications

  • Genetic Engineering and CRISPR Technology
  • Cell-based Therapies and Regenerative Medicine
  • Advanced Cell Models for Drug Development
  • Bioprocessing and Scalable Cell Culture Systems
  • Final Research Project Proposal

Career Opportunities

Graduates of the Master of Science by Research in Cell Engineering from the University of Glasgow are well-prepared for careers in biomedical engineering, cell therapy, and regenerative medicine. Career opportunities include roles in biotechnology companies, pharmaceutical research, medical device development, and academic research institutions. Graduates can work as cell biotechnologists, research scientists, or product development specialists, contributing to innovations in drug development, tissue engineering, and personalized medicine.
